Abstract
We present in this work the processing and characterization of two semicond uctor thin films (ZnS and ZnxCd1-xO) grown by chemical bath deposition (CBD ), and used as heterojunction partners on CSVT-CdTte films. The photovoltai c properties of the ZnxCd1-xO/CdTe heterojunction are reported here for the first time. The analysis of the basic properties of the films was carried out by standard optical and electrical characterization techniques. The het erojunction systems were studied by means of I-V characteristics, spectral response and quasi-static C-V measurements. Short-circuit currents of 8.9 a nd 22 mA/cm(2), open-circuit voltages of 0.489 V and 0.324 V, All factors o f 0.29 and 0.42 and conversion efficiencies of 1.26 and 3.12% were obtained for SnO2/Zn0.9Cd0.1/CdTe and SnO2/ZnS/CdTe, respectively, under normalized 100 mW/cm(2) illumination (AM1).
